Background
Funded by the Government and People of Japan, the UNITAR programme “Empowering Youth and Women amid Economic Instability” supports young people and women across sub-Saharan Africa to turn emerging challenges into opportunities for Entrepreneurship, innovation and inclusive economic growth. Bringing together participants from 11 African countries, the programme combines business development, digital and AI literacy, leadership, sustainable development and investment readiness to help participants build viable ventures, strengthen partnerships and develop solutions to pressing challenges – from food security and climate resilience to employment, trade and digital transformation.
Aligned with the spirit of the 9th Tokyo International Conference on African Development (TICAD9), the programme aims to strengthen connections between African and Japanese innovation ecosystems and equip a new generation of entrepreneurs and changemakers to create sustainable economic value.
Event Objectives
To formally launch the "Empowering Youth and Women amid Economic Instability: Enhancing Public-Private Partnership between Japan and Africa for Sub-Saharan African Countries, Addressing Urgent Challenges, and Promoting TICAD9" Programme; and
To orient the Programme participants on the learning pathway, access to the learning management system, and what success looks like for Phase I.
